How do I improve and maintain my CD4 count?

I am HIV positive and my CD4 count is 696. How can I improve it or maintain it?


In general, the only way to increase your CD4 count is to use HIV treatment (ART).

No other products can increase your CD4 count – not vitamins, supplements or herbal remedies.

ART works by stopping the virus from replicating.  As your viral load is reduced your CD4 count will start to rise again.

Lifestyle changes can still be very important for your general health. Eating a nutritious balanced diet, exercising regularly, reducing stress, sleeping well and stopping smoking can help to maintain a healthy immune system. These things are good for your health but just don’t have a direct impact on your CD4 count.

When you use ART, the information at this link on starting treatment will help.

Knowing about and understanding ART will help you feel in control over your treatment.

This answer was updated in January 2016 from a question first posted on 8 March 2012.


  1. Michael

    Hello my name is Michael and I am.hiv positive…I just went for blood tests and I found that my cd4 count is 164 and cd3 is 77%..is that normal? I am already taking Avonza pills

  2. Roy Trevelion

    Hi Barry,
    It’s important to take them around the same time. But once you’re stable and undetectable on treatment you can aim for a certain time and give yourself an hour either way – before or after. Many people find it easier to take ARVs at a time when they’re regularly doing something else. And with Trivenz it’s recommended to take them just before bedtime. Please see this link for more info.

    If you’re going to be in a new time zone and the time is very different, you probably need to change the time you take them. But you can switch when you arrive and carry on at that new time everyday. When you return you can switch back. But if it’s just an hour difference you could stick to the same time while you’re away.

  3. Barry

    I have a question about when to drink my ARV medication, i am on Trivenz, is it important to drink it everyday at the same time?

    Also i will be traveling to a different time zone can i start drinking my medication earlier to fit to the destinations time zone?

  4. Lisa Thorley

    Hi Klaas,

    How are you coping with your diagnoses? Are you able to get any support?

    The best way to keep healthy is to take your ARVs and TB meds. This is because you need to get rid of the TB and because the ARVs will help your CD4 to rise. This will in turn help your HIV.

    Other than that, eat well, and look after yourself and also make sure that you take your meds as prescribed. Also because your CD4 is 100 you’re more vulnerable to opportunistic infections. In some countries co-trimoxazole (often called Setrin or Bactrim) is given as a prophylaxis to be taken daily to prevent pneumonia and other infections.

    If you haven’t been given this, you could talk to your doctor about this.

  5. klaas

    Result came back positive. CD4 count is 100 and I also have TB. I’m taking ARVs and meds for TB. Do you have any advice on how to keep healthy?

  6. mamaria

    How do i increase my 437 CD4 count

  7. Roy Trevelion

    Taking HIV treatment is the only way to increase your CD4 count. HIV meds are really effective at keeping HIV under control. Having a viral load below 50 helps your CD4 count to increase.

  8. Rebecca McDowall

    Hi Mpumelelo,
    Abstaining from sex will not make any difference to your CD4 count. It is fine to have sex when you are HIV positive and this will not have a negative affect on the CD4 count.

    The only way to maintain or increase your CD4 count is to take ARVs. Are you on treatment?

  9. mpumelelo

    i have abstained sex for a year and cd4count picked by 209 how can i maintain it because i now have a relationship

  10. vukile

    Thanks about your help


